So I'm having some trouble getting a super solid picture with my setup. If I run video straight from the Naomi's VGA into my 480p monitor I don't have any sort of noise in the image.

Current setup is VGA from the Naomi into a powered VGA splitter (I've verified this isn't an issue by not using it and still having the issue). One VGA goes into a Kenzei sync combiner which runs 480p over scart into my XRGB Mini. The other VGA goes straight to my TATE monitor. I know the scart cable as well as the VGA cables are fine as I have the issue on cords I know work fine. I also know it's not the Kenzei as I do not have the issue with my Dreamcast.

I also have the issue, albiet slightly less bad, if i run the VGA into my Capcom i/o and pull the video from the jamma harness.
